tools

package
v0.1.5 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 15, 2025 License: Apache-2.0 Imports: 23 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func AllPlatform

func AllPlatform() *platformAll

func Check

func Check(tools ...Tool) error

func RunDaemon

func RunDaemon(name, command string, healthCheck func() bool, timeout time.Duration) error

Types

type Tool

type Tool interface {
	GetName() string
	IsInstalled() bool
	LinuxInstall() error
	WindowsInstall() error
}

func Consul

func Consul() Tool

func Dapr

func Dapr() Tool

func Golang

func Golang() Tool

func Protoc

func Protoc() Tool

func ProtocGo added in v0.0.3

func ProtocGo() Tool

func ProtocGoGRPC added in v0.0.3

func ProtocGoGRPC() Tool

func ProtocGogoFaster

func ProtocGogoFaster() Tool

func Sqlboiler

func Sqlboiler() Tool

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L